Thanks! I had installed puredyne 11-amd64 Linux, which includes SC 3.1. Then I built and installed SuperCollider from source for 3.4RC and scons intall'ed it. SC still returned 3.1 as its version. It turns out that puredyne puts SC in /usr whereas the Sconstruct file downloaded with the source puts it in /usr/local by default, so the original was not replaced. Anyone using puredyne and building Supercollider from source should remove the original first and install the new build with scons install PREFIX=/usr.
